Route Description
Everything you need to know about the corridor Cuernavaca - New York City
The logistics corridor connecting Cuernavaca, Morelos to Nueva York, New York represents a vital cross-border transportation route spanning approximately 3,409 kilometers. This corridor serves as a crucial link between Mexico's industrial heartland and one of the United States' most important economic hubs. The route traverses diverse terrain and crosses multiple state and international boundaries, requiring specialized expertise in cross-border logistics operations.
The economic significance of this corridor is substantial, facilitating the movement of goods between Mexico's manufacturing centers and the northeastern United States. Major industries utilizing this route include automotive components, electronics, agricultural products, and manufactured goods. The corridor supports just-in-time inventory systems and supply chain optimization for companies operating in both countries.
Transportation infrastructure along this route includes major highways such as Mexican Federal Highways 95D and 85D, connecting to U.S. Interstate systems including I-35 and I-95. Key border crossings at Laredo/Nuevo Laredo and other points require careful coordination of customs procedures and documentation. Origin
Cuernavaca, located in the state of Morelos, Mexico, serves as a strategic logistics hub due to its proximity to Mexico City and its position within the country's industrial corridor. The city benefits from excellent connectivity through Federal Highway 95D, providing direct access to major ports and border crossings. Morelos has developed as an important manufacturing center, particularly in the automotive, electronics, and food processing industries. The region's transportation infrastructure includes modern highways, rail connections, and proximity to Mexico City's international airport, facilitating efficient distribution of goods throughout Mexico and beyond.
Destination
New York City
Nueva York, New York stands as one of the most significant logistics and economic centers in the United States. The metropolitan area boasts extensive transportation infrastructure including major airports, port facilities, and an intricate highway network. New York's economy encompasses diverse sectors including finance, media, technology, and manufacturing, creating substantial demand for freight transportation services. The region's strategic location on the East Coast provides access to major markets along the Atlantic seaboard and serves as a gateway for international trade. The area's sophisticated logistics ecosystem supports complex supply chain operations for businesses of all sizes.
